"I Have Always Dreamt of Making my Debut at Lord's" : Azhar Ali

Details
Right handed KRL batsman Azhar Ali's dream has always been to make his international d?but at Lord's. That dream could become reality after Azhar was named in the Pakistan test squad to tour England this summer, especially given that Pakistan's first test match this summer in England on 13th July against Australia is at the home of cricket.

“I am more determined than ever to make a comeback!” - Fawad Alam

Details
At the relatively tender age of 24, few players have gone through as many triumphs and disappointments as Fawad Alam. The young left-hander has gone through a lot in the past year; from the highs of winning a World Cup, scoring a wonderful century away from home in his debut Test, to the lows of being unceremoniously axed from both the Tests and the ODI formats.

‘I won’t be in England just to make up the numbers' – Zulqarnain Haider

Details
Three years is a long time to wait for a recall to the national team, especially in Pakistani cricket. Many never get the chance to disprove their doubters. Zulqarnain Haider is one of the lucky few who has been given a chance to re-establish himself as an international cricketer. He has been drafted in as backup wicketkeeper to Kamran Akmal for the Test series vs. England and Australia.

"I was Injured not Underperforming" Rana Naved ul Hasan

Details
Rana Naved ul Hasan's appeal against his one year ban and Rs 2-million fine by the Pakistan Cricket Board is due to be heard on 19th June. Naved who was banned by the Pakistan Cricket Board due to underperformance on the disastrous tour of Australia earlier this year, told PakPassion.net that he is eager to clear his name of any charges.
